#include<stdio.h>int main(){ int b[4][4]; int j,j,a,b,temp;temp=b[0][0] for(i=0;i<4;i++) for(j=0;j<4;j++){ if(temp
1.二维数组的max,min #include <stdio.h>intmain() {inta[2][3] = {{1,2,3}, {4,5,6}};inti, j,max;for(i =0; i <2; i++) { max= a[0][0];for(j =0; j <3; j++) {if(a[i][j] >max) { max=a[i][j]; } } } printf("数组的最大值是%d", max);return0; }...
函数返回的最大值类型要与二维数组元素类型一致。 比如二维数组是int型,返回值也应为int型。在实际应用中,二维数组最大值函数有多种用途。比如在图像数据处理中可找到像素值的最大值。在数据分析领域能确定某二维数据集中的最大数值。可以将此函数封装在一个库中方便其他程序调用。调用函数时要确保传入正确的二维...
#include <stdio.h>intmain() {inta[4][4]= {10,20,34,51,66,72,85,91,12,11,12,13,14,16,15};intmax=a[0][0];//先从数组中随便定义一个最大值inti,j;intrower;//行标intcolunmns;//列标for(i=0; i<4; i++) {for(j=0; j<4; j++) {if(a[i][j]>max) { max=a[i][j...
Ⅰ、输出二维数组中的最大值: ①、//代码摘下直接可以运行 //输出二维数组的最大值 #include<stdio.h> #include<math.h> #include<stdlib.h> //用法如下 int main() { int i,j,a[10][10],temp=0; printf(“Output the number of arra... ...
首先,我们需要定义一个3x3的二维数组,并对其进行初始化。在C语言中,可以通过嵌套循环来初始化数组元素。 c #include <stdio.h> #include <limits.h> int main() { int array[3][3] = { {1, 2, 3}, {4, 5, 6}, {7, 8, 9} }; // 初始化最大值和最小值 int max = INT...
void main() { int a[3][3]={{3,5,8},{12,5,81},{33,55,77}}; int i,j,max,k,n; max=a[0][0]; for(i=0;i<3;i++) for(j=0;j<3;j++) { if(a[i][j]>max) max=a[i][j]; k=i;n=j; } printf("%d\t%2d%2d",a[k][n],k,n); }...
c语言二维数组求最大值 c语⾔⼆维数组求最⼤值 1 #include<stdio.h> 2int main()3 { 4int i,j,row=0,colum=0,max;5int a[3][4]={{1,2,3,4},{9,8,7,6},{-10,10,-5,2}};6 max=a[0][0];7for (i=0;i<=2;i++)8 { 9for (j=0;j<=3;j++)10 { 11if (...
从键盘输入一个3*4的二维数组,用C语言求出其中的最大值。 程序如下: #include <stdio.h> int main() { int a[3][4]; int i,j,t,Max; printf("请从键盘输入二维数组的元素:\n"); for(i=0;i<3;i++) for(j=0;j<4;j++) scanf("%d",&a[i][j]); ...
第一行为二维数组的行数m和列数n(2<n m<11) 然后是m*n个元素 输出 一行输出,分别为最大值,行下标、列下标,数与数之间用一个空格分开。 输入样列 3 2 1 5 2 15 5 3 输出样例 15 1 1 出处 ymc 答案: #include <stdio.h> int hmax; int lmax; int fun(int zu[10][11],int m, int n)...